➀ HOW TO DRIVE √
To drive the vehicle, right click it and select the option "Ride" from the pie menu. Click on the motorcycle for the menu.
From here you can access the handling options and position adjust as well as the lock system, resizer, lights, etc.
• RIDING
Use the arrow keys to accelerate, brake, and steer. For sharp turns at speed, skid out by holding the back arrow while turning.
• QUICK-START
Key combo, if you are in park mode and press the up and down arrow keys, the bike will un-park and the engine will start.
• SHIFTING
Choose between two shifting styles by choosing Shift Style from the > Options, > Advanced menu.
Standard: To shift gears, hold the SHIFT key and tap the left or right arrow key.
Old School: Shift with E/C or PageUp/PageDown keys
• DRIVING REVERSE
To drive in reverse you will need to select reverse gear, unless Arcade Reverse is activated from the menu.
• NOS/RECOVERY
Holding the forward/backward arrow together can activate NOS Boost or Recover, depending on what is set in the menu.
NOS applies a momentary extra forward boost as set in the menu.
Recover lifts the bike up to un-stick it from hazards.
• WHEELIE
For wheelie, use the E key or PageUp, use C or PageDown to nose down.
If using Old School shift style, to activate wheelie you can hold down the back arrow then press E or PageUp.
Wheelie strength can be adjusted from the > Options, > Controls, > Turbo menu.
• PARKING
While the vehicle is parked, the Left/Right Arrow keys will cycle through the park poses.
(only if more park poses are included in the bike)
• BURNOUT
To activate burnout, hold down back arrow and tap C key or Page Down.
➁ THE VEHICLE MENU √
The vehicle menu is triggered on touch by the vehicle owner. If the vehicle is unlocked, a guest driver may trigger the menu while seated.
Some functions can only be accessed while seated. Passenger seat menu is accessed by touching the particular passenger seats,
the passenger must be seated on the bike to access the menu. Driver can also access to the menu of the passenger seat to adjust the pose.
(Menu > Position > Tools > Passenger)
• Options Menu
Passenger - you can turn on/off the seat for passengers
Automatic / Manual - change transmission type
Alarm - turn on/off the alarm system
Eject - ejects any seated passengers
Autolights - turns on or off the autolights system
Camera - adjust camera settings
Controls - adjust many engine and performance settings (see "Point 3" for more information)

➂ OPTIMIZING YOUR BIKE √
• GEARS MENU
From this menu you can adjust, add and remove gear values.
Select a gear from the menu to edit. You can lower or raise the gear strength with Gear - or Gear + or use Kill Gear to remove it.
Add Gear creates a new top gear. You can then select that gear from the menu and adjust it.
• REVERSE MENU
From here you can adjust the strength of your reverse gear.
You can also turn on or off Arcade Reverse by selecting Rev Style
• BRAKE MENU
Here you can adjust the motorcycle braking power.
You can also adjust the inertia and decay values which affect vehicle physics friction.
• SKID MENU
The settings here control how long and how much the vehicle will skid when the turn+back arrow key controls are used.
• BANKING MENU
Banking power affects how much the vehicle leans over when turning.
• TURBO MENU
The Turbo menu has settings to adjust the turbo power, wheelie up/down, and NOS boost.
• STEERING MENU
Here ( and the > More selection) is where to adjust Steering, VelMult, Turn Bonus, Drift and Resist values.
Steering - the main power applied to the vehicle for turning.
VelMult - is an extreme powered steering booster that is scaled by velocity. It is mostly used for larger vehicles.
A small setting such as 0.1 can give an average vehicle an additional steering advantage at higher speeds.
Drift - adjusts the amount of sideways slide on corners.
Bonus - is an additional steering power that increases the longer you hold the control key.
Resist - this works like a kind of friction for the turning rotation axis.
Adjust this if your motorcycle oversteers or does not steer enough after adjusting steering and Bonus.
